Flavan-3-ol-enriched dark chocolate and white chocolate improve acute measures of platelet function in a gender-specific way--a randomized-controlled human intervention trial.

机构信息

Rowett Institute of Nutrition and Health, University of Aberdeen, Aberdeen, UK.

出版信息

Mol Nutr Food Res. 2013 Feb;57(2):191-202. doi: 10.1002/mnfr.201200283. Epub 2012 Nov 8.

Abstract

SCOPE

We examined whether flavan-3-ol-enriched dark chocolate, compared with standard dark and white chocolate, beneficially affects platelet function in healthy subjects, and whether this relates to flavan-3-ol bioavailability.

METHODS AND RESULTS

A total of 42 healthy subjects received an acute dose of flavan-3-ol-enriched dark, standard dark or white chocolate, in random order. Blood and urine samples were obtained just before and 2 and 6 h after consumption for measurements of platelet function, and bioavailability and excretion of flavan-3-ols. Flavan-3-ol-enriched dark chocolate significantly decreased adenosine diphosphate-induced platelet aggregation and P-selectin expression in men (all p ≤ 0.020), decreased thrombin receptor-activating peptide-induced platelet aggregation and increased thrombin receptor-activating peptide-induced fibrinogen binding in women (both p ≤ 0.041), and increased collagen/epinephrine-induced ex vivo bleeding time in men and women (p ≤ 0.042). White chocolate significantly decreased adenosine diphosphate-induced platelet P-selectin expression (p = 0.002) and increased collagen/epinephrine-induced ex vivo bleeding time (p = 0.042) in men only. Differences in efficacy by which flavan-3-ols affect platelet function were only partially explained by concentrations of flavan-3-ols and their metabolites in plasma or urine.

CONCLUSION

Flavan-3-ols in dark chocolate, but also compounds in white chocolate, can improve platelet function, dependent on gender, and may thus beneficially affect atherogenesis.

摘要

范围

我们研究了富含黄烷-3-醇的黑巧克力与标准黑巧克力和白巧克力相比,是否能有益地影响健康受试者的血小板功能,以及这是否与黄烷-3-醇的生物利用度有关。

方法和结果

共有 42 名健康受试者随机接受富含黄烷-3-醇的黑巧克力、标准黑巧克力或白巧克力的急性剂量。在摄入前、摄入后 2 小时和 6 小时采集血液和尿液样本,用于测量血小板功能以及黄烷-3-醇的生物利用度和排泄。富含黄烷-3-醇的黑巧克力可显著降低男性的二磷酸腺苷诱导的血小板聚集和 P-选择素表达(均 p ≤ 0.020),降低女性的凝血酶受体激活肽诱导的血小板聚集和增加凝血酶受体激活肽诱导的纤维蛋白原结合(均 p ≤ 0.041),并增加男性和女性胶原/肾上腺素诱导的体外出血时间(p ≤ 0.042)。白巧克力仅可显著降低男性的二磷酸腺苷诱导的血小板 P-选择素表达(p = 0.002)和增加胶原/肾上腺素诱导的体外出血时间(p = 0.042)。黄烷-3-醇影响血小板功能的功效差异仅部分可通过黄烷-3-醇及其代谢物在血浆或尿液中的浓度来解释。

结论

黑巧克力中的黄烷-3-醇,以及白巧克力中的化合物,可以改善血小板功能,这取决于性别,并且可能因此有益于动脉粥样硬化的形成。
